Storage Considerations: 128GB SSD

The 128GB SSD is a double-edged sword. On one hand, it makes the laptop fast and responsive. On the other hand, it offers very limited space.

A typical Windows installation takes up about 30 to 40GB. Add your browser, office software, and a few files, and you are already at 50GB or more. That leaves you with limited room for personal files, photos, and additional apps.

Tips to Manage 128GB of Storage

  • Use cloud storage services like Google Drive or OneDrive for files.
  • Regularly delete temporary files and clear your browser cache.
  • Store large files like photos and videos on an external drive.
  • Uninstall apps you no longer use.
  • Consider upgrading to a larger SSD if the laptop supports it.

Overlooking the Operating System Requirements

Windows 11 requires a minimum of 4GB RAM and 64GB of storage. While this laptop meets those requirements, the experience will be smoother with more resources. Keep this in mind as Microsoft continues to update its software.

Not Checking Compatibility for Upgrades

Before buying, confirm that the laptop supports RAM and SSD upgrades. Some budget models have soldered components that cannot be replaced. Check the specifications or contact HP support to be sure.
